#a67b23 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a67b23 is composed of 65.1% red, 48.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 78.9%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 40.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#a67b23 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ff646 with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a67b23 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#a67b23 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a67b23 has RGB values of R:166, G:123,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.79,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10910499.

Shades and Tints of #a67b23

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f3 is the lightest one.
